Step-by-step construction of a house from foam blocks

Step #1. Paperwork.

To get started, you'll need documentation. To start building a house with a clear conscience, solve all the formal procedures - obtain building permits, for the site, develop or modernize water supply systems, drainage, heating and electricity issues.

A rationally laid out water supply system is the key to comfort

Step #2. Order in the workplace.

Avoid the usual order of things. A construction site is not a dirty place where everything around is dangerous and chaotic. Provide water supply to the construction site, allocate a special place for tools and building materials. The area should be clean - no nails, screws or scraps of foam blocks. There should be a designated area for you and those who will help you, tools should be protected from rain, covered with a thick tarpaulin, if necessary.

Mark all future structures on the site, think through everything in advance, including the number of people you may need.

Step #3. Construction materials and soil preparation.

Construction of the foundation is considered one of the main stages of building a house. You will have to consult with many people and read a lot of literature.

Preparing the soil for strip foundation

The most the best option is a strip foundation. According to the project, you need to make precise markings on the site, according to which you will dig a pit, either manually or using machinery.

Step No. 4. Pit.

Before laying the foundation, sand must be poured into the pit (the layer thickness is no more than 0.25-0.3 m of sand). It is necessary to pour crushed stone on top of the sand - its thickness should be the same. After compaction, the concrete pad can be considered ready. After this, it is necessary to assemble the reinforcement frame.

Pit filling scheme

The reinforcement must be attached to each other as firmly as possible and high level- no slipping or shifting.

Installation of formwork

The next stage is the installation of formwork. You will need strong boards that will be fastened into a shield. They must be placed strictly parallel to each other, otherwise the pit will not be level. From above, all panels must be connected to each other with transverse wooden fasteners.

Now it’s time to prepare the concrete: one volume of cement + sand (three units) + small crushed stone. The solution is poured onto the pillow, then erect the entire structure. The foundation tape should have a width of 0.3 to 0.5 m and a height of 0.7 m or more.

If you have completed the foundation, now it’s time to start bringing in building materials: foam blocks, glue, reinforcing rods, waterproofing.

Step #5. Walling.

Construction can begin, which means start building walls. Having processed the foundation waterproofing materials, you can start laying foam blocks. To do this, use special notched spatulas.

Coating the foam block with a solution

It should be noted that laying walls is a pleasant job (from the point of view of visibility of the result), but not easy. Particular care must be taken to place the first row of blocks. The quality of further rows depends on its evenness.

Start of construction of walls

Do not forget that the strength of the house depends not only on the material, but also on the principles of masonry - use the binding of foam blocks exactly as with brick: in each row, move the blocks according to the principle of “row relative to the previous row” by half the length of the foam block. This type of masonry will make a great contribution to the strength of the future home.

Dilution of glue for foam blocks

Glue for foam blocks must be prepared according to the recommendations on the packaging; with a notched trowel, it must first be applied to the side edges of the blocks, and then to the bottom. Then lay the block. The level needs to be checked not every row placed, but every block placed. Yes, the work is painstaking, but the result will bring you so much joy and pride that it is worth it.

Reinforcement and insulation of walls

Reinforcement is the key to strength. The reinforcement procedure is very important. Those who complain about the fragility of a house built from foam blocks, as a rule, initially decided to save on reinforcement. It is this process that prevents cracks from appearing in the future. After you have laid out the first row of foam blocks, you need to make grooves on their surface using a wall cutter (as a rule, a size of 0.4 m x 0.4 m is sufficient, and at the same time step back from the edge of each block by at least 6 cm). Make two grooves, they should be parallel and have rounded corners. Be sure to clean the grooves from any remaining dust, after which the adhesive solution should be poured into them. Place reinforcing rod inside. Then continue laying the rows. Every 3-4 rows it is necessary to repeat laying the armored belt. Some builders reinforce each row, this significantly slows down the construction process, but we can only guess how much this strengthens the structure!

Cleaning grooves for armored belts

You should know that when working on window and doorways, we should not forget about metal corners. The length of the corner to be laid (placed above the future window and doors) must be at least 0.6 m greater than the width of the opening itself.

According to observations, a team of 4 people copes with the construction of the walls of a 120-meter house on average in a week. If you work at a relaxed pace, three weeks will be enough.

Construction of the foundation. Sequencing

For foam block buildings, a strip foundation is usually made, which is a closed loop under all load-bearing walls. First you need to mark the area and designate the places where communications will be laid. Then you should dig a pit approximately 80-170 cm deep: the level depends on how deeply the soil freezes. The length and width of the pit correspond to the dimensions of the future house; you only need a margin of 0.6-1 m on each side.

Advice. Do not take the excavated soil far away: it may be useful when planting a vegetable garden.

At the bottom of the pit you need to make a “pillow”: pour sand, gravel or crushed stone. The thickness of the layer is 20-30 cm. It should be compacted. To do this, the “cushion” is filled with water, and after a while it is compacted again. If the area has damp soil, you can lay polyethylene on top.

Construction of the foundation

After this, a frame is assembled, which makes the structure stronger. Steel reinforcement bars are installed vertically to the height of the foundation. The distance is 1-1.5 m. They are connected to each other with horizontal rods, and the entire base is connected by welding. Then formwork is constructed - temporary wood flooring in the form of a shield, which is necessary for proper pouring of concrete.

The height of the formwork must be at least 70 cm. The distance between the two decks depends on the thickness of the walls and is on average 30-50 cm. The panels are installed parallel to each other, and connected on top with wooden lintels. The reinforcement base should be inside.

Reinforcement

It is quite possible to prepare concrete for pouring yourself by mixing cement, sand and crushed stone in a ratio of 1:3:5. The resulting solution should be thick, take the shape of a slide and not spread. Pouring inside the formwork is done in stages; during the process, the concrete is compacted with a shovel to prevent bubbles from appearing.

After covering the foundation with film, you need to wait for it to dry completely. This usually takes up to 4 weeks. After this, the formwork is removed, and waterproofing is done on top of the foundation, lining the entire perimeter, for example, with roofing felt.

Attention! While the concrete is drying, it must be carefully protected from sunlight and periodically moistened.

Construction of walls. How to make the right masonry

If you watch a thematic video for construction beginners, you will see that the craftsmen begin the construction of walls from the corners, and first of all mark the highest of them. To begin with, 4-5 blocks are laid on each corner. After this, they pull the rope between the resulting columns and begin laying the first row. It is done using cement-sand mortar. Subsequently, a special adhesive solution is used, the layer thickness is up to 3 mm. For application it is better to use a notched trowel.

Further construction depends on the first row. To avoid distortion of the structure, you need to constantly check the correctness of the vertical and horizontal lines using a level or level. Each subsequent row should be offset by approximately half a block relative to the previous one. To do this, use either masonry in a ring, or start from the corners, moving towards the center of each wall.

Start laying foam blocks from the corner

Sometimes a solid foam block needs to be cut so that it fits firmly into the row. A grinder or hacksaw is suitable for these purposes. Coat the resulting fragment with adhesive solution on both sides and place it in the gap. To ensure it fits tightly, use a rubber mallet. With its help, you can reduce the distances between blocks to a minimum, and therefore prevent the appearance of “cold bridges”. The cracks between the foam blocks are covered with a solution.

Between the first and second rows, reinforcement (strengthening) of the walls is made. Suitable for these purposes:

  • plastic mesh;
  • metal grid;
  • fittings

The mesh needs to be laid on top of a row of foam blocks and filled with adhesive solution. If you use rods (reinforcement), use a wall chaser to make 2 parallel channels 4 x 4 cm around the entire perimeter of the structure. The distance to the outside of the foam block should be at least 6 cm. The resulting channels are cleaned of dust, filled with glue and reinforcement with a diameter of 0.8 cm is placed in them, bending it at the corners.

Attention! Reinforcement should be done every 4-5 rows of masonry.

The construction of walls must be done taking into account openings for doors and windows. A reinforcing element should be placed above them. Most often this is a steel corner 8 x 8 cm. In this case, the length of the corner should be at least 60 cm greater than the width of the opening. Sometimes they use reinforced concrete floor. At the bottom and top of the window, foam block formwork is installed, which is reinforced and filled with concrete.

Anchor bolts in foam block

The final row is laid 2 cm below the intended ceiling of the house. The gap that appears is covered with plaster. This technique will reduce the load on internal partitions. Before installing the ceiling, a reinforcing belt must be made around the entire perimeter of the structure. Its width coincides with the width of the wall, and its height is 10-20 cm. The diameter of the reinforcement, as well as the number of rods, depends on the distance between the load-bearing walls.

Continuing the conversation about the benefits that a developer receives when choosing foam blocks as a material for building a house, we should mention one of the main qualities - excellent thermal insulation properties.

Air is known to be the best heat insulator. In foam concrete, air bubbles occupy from 10 to 87% of the total volume (in 2003, a technology for producing super-light foam concrete was patented in Russia, in which, through the use of microsilica and chopped fiberglass, the share of air is 92 - 96 percent by volume, without loss of strength! ). This determines its thermal insulation properties. The thermal conductivity coefficient, depending on the brand, is in the range of 0.10 - 0.38 W/(m * oC).

For comparison:
- silicate brick 0.81
- reinforced concrete 1.70
- wood (15% humidity) 0.15
- cement board 1.92
- stone 1.40

Thus, the thermal protection provided by foam concrete is at the level of wooden walls. As a result, by retaining heat in residential premises, 30% of heating costs are saved during the cold season. In addition, foam blocks, unlike brick and heavy concrete, fully comply with the new legal requirements that define standards thermal insulation properties building materials.

Due to its structure, foam concrete has another positive quality. It has a high degree of sound insulation (D coefficient = 58 dB). Sound waves are crushed and dampened by the tiny walls of numerous air cells.

For comparison:
- plastered wall with ½ brick 44
- plastered wall with 1 brick 50
- concrete slab 48
- double window 30
- single door 18

Any rigid building material, into the pores of which moisture can penetrate, must be protected from the effects of atmospheric factors using plaster, facing tiles, etc. If this is not done, during the cold season the water that gets inside will freeze, which will ultimately lead to the destruction of the integrity of the structure.

In foam concrete, the air cells are closed, i.e. do not communicate with each other, so the foam blocks do not absorb water. This ensures their frost resistance. During laboratory tests, a foam concrete slab successfully withstood 80 freeze-thaw cycles. This is confirmed by the characteristics of the material - structural foam blocks have a frost resistance grade of “F 75” (the “F” value determines the number of cycles at – 100 °C).

If we express positive properties foam blocks briefly, we can say that they combine best qualities stone and wood, and at the same time free from their inherent disadvantages. For example, wood is afraid of fire, while foam concrete belongs to the group of non-combustible materials. According to the requirements of SNiP P-3-79 “Building Heat Engineering”, it can withstand one-sided exposure to fire for at least 120 minutes (in practice – 5, 7 hours). The fire resistance limit (i.e., the time from the beginning of contact with fire to the destruction of the material or heating of its opposite wall to 220 ° C) of a wall made of foam blocks with a thickness of 18 to 36 cm is REI 240.

Foam blocks significantly reduce the cost of construction. In terms of cost, including savings on cement mortar, they are 2 - 2.5 times cheaper than bricks. In addition, one standard foam block is equal to 14 bricks, which significantly speeds up the laying of walls and reduces labor costs for masons. As well as workers who will carry out the laying of utilities, since foam concrete is easy to process, so work at the final stage of construction will be carried out faster and easier.

The low specific gravity of the material (grade D 600 is three times lighter than solid brick, which has a density of 1600 - 1900 kg/m3) allows you to lay a lightweight foundation, which will also require less money. Due to the high geometric accuracy of the dimensions of the foam blocks and the use of glue, the appearance of “cold bridges” is eliminated, which makes it possible to lay a layer of plaster twice as thin. Transportation of this material is also cheaper due to optimal combination low weight, volume and packaging.

Foundation

The first step is to create a foundation that can support a house made of foam blocks:

  1. We make calculations of the width and depth of the formwork system. The width is equal to cross section structure under construction, and the lowest point depends on the climatic conditions of the area and the degree of soil freezing. The depth of the foundation must be at least 500 mm.
  2. Next, a trench is dug, the depth of which is about two meters.
  3. Coarse sand (300 mm) is placed at the bottom of the trench. Then the sand cushion is moistened with water and compacted well.
  4. To give the foundation precise shapes, formwork is placed and strips of roofing felt are secured.
  5. A fastening belt made of reinforcement is installed along the perimeter of the trench.
  6. After which you can fill the foundation with a special solution (5 parts of crushed stone, 3 parts of sand, and 1 part of cement).
  7. We move the formwork, increasing the construction of the foundation. During pouring for laying sewerage systems, asbestos pipes are laid in places specified according to the scheme.
  8. Every 50 cm concrete mortar should be compacted.
  9. The foundation will “mature” for at least a month. During hardening, cover it from ultraviolet radiation and periodically moisten it with water.
  10. On top concrete structure it is necessary to roll out the moisture-proofing material.
  11. WITH outside a blind area is constructed, its width is from one to two meters, and its height is 150 mm. This is done so that natural precipitation is removed from the first floor or basement. It must be divided into sections to prevent various deformations or ruptures.
